Output f301f1755cc58bb1184e006cc0627d6929beee46793805fb650d064bcde98907:1

value
42560537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a7b0aae97d30eb78127fc0e3fd7e32be1492785 OP_EQUAL
address
MDENpePM7hgqhuuFS3wXq8VDxVpsgMU83a
transaction
f301f1755cc58bb1184e006cc0627d6929beee46793805fb650d064bcde98907
spent
true